I have a newer version of OVZAdmin.

ovzadmin-pre3

Changes;

1. Slim down code,and got rid of useless verbose prompts.
2. Supports disk-quotas for VE at build time.
3. Changed simple text database default directory to;

/var/log/vpsdatabase

If you do not have it,no worries.

4. The default VE config was changed from older version of OVZ,
to reflect newer versions.
A VE config is "unlimited".

5. "GUI" is sleeker.(at least for text)

Right now,I'm going over some submitted coding that looks promising,so it will speed things up a bit.
VE maintenance options are still not complete.
Node Administration will be incorporated with some of the submitted code,and some I found.
You may still want your own.
No screen shots,as the ones posted,gets you in the ball park.
